Why You Can’t Add a Venmo Card to Apple Wallet?

To get a better understanding of why this problem may be occurring, let’s share a little bit of background between both companies.

Besides being available for Android users, Venmo is also available for iOS users. Only iOS users can use Apple Wallet. 

Besides supporting most credit and debit cards from banks, Apple Wallet also has its own debit card, Apple Cash.

Furthermore, Venmo can be used not only as a payment method but also as a wallet to store your money. A debit card is also available through Venmo that is linked to an account balance.

As a result, Venmo and Apple Pay® are clearly competitors with similar features. It may be because of this that they do not cooperate.

Adding a Debit Card to Venmo to Cash Out

After learning that Venmo can be used to transfer money from Apple Wallet to Venmo, you may want to link a debit card as soon as possible. Adding a debit card to Venmo for Apple Wallet transfer is easy with these step-by-step instructions.

  1. You can use your Venmo account details to log into the Venmo app on your phone.
  2. Using the “You” tab, select the icon representing a single person.
  3. Click “Payment Methods” in the setting gear.
  4. Click “Card” under “Add Bank or Card”.
  5. Save your changes after entering your debit card information in the text field provided.

How to Move Funds From Apple Wallet to a Linked Debit Card?

The next step you might need to know if you’re new to Venmo is how to transfer funds from Apple Wallet to a debit card. This is how it works.

  • Open Apple Wallet on your iPhone
  • You can access your “Apple Cash Card” by tapping on the Apple icon at the top of the screen
  • Select the three-dot “More” icon
  • Choose “Transfer to Bank”
  • Select “Next” after entering the amount you wish to transfer
  • Click “Instant Transfer” and enter your debit card information
